Title:
|
 |
Cryo-electron microscopy of tubular arrays of HIV-1 gag resolves structures essential for immature virus assembly.
|
|
Structure:
|
 |
Gag protein. Chain: a, b, c, d, e, f. Fragment: capsid, residues 1-219. Engineered: yes. Mutation: yes. Other_details: 10nm protein-a conjugated gold particles were added to the sample. Protein construct consists of ca to nc domains with mutation in position y169.
|
|
Source:
|
 |
Human immunodeficiency virus 1. Organism_taxid: 11676. Expressed in: escherichia coli. Expression_system_taxid: 469008.
